Revocation of License: Any license issued pursuant to this chapter, licensed pursuant to <br />Minnesota statutes, chapter 340A, shall be revoked if any of the acts of conduct described <br />in this section occur on the licensed premises. (Ord. 808, 11-21-1977; amd. 1995 Code) <br />302.15: CIVIL PENALTY: <br />A. Penalty For Noncompliance: In addition to any criminal penalties which may be imposed by <br />a court of law, the City Council may suspend a license for up to 60 days, may revoke a <br />license and/or may impose a civil fine on a licensee not to exceed $2,000.00 for each <br />violation on a finding that the license holder or its employee has failed to comply with a <br />statute, rule or ordinance relating to alcoholic beverages, non-intoxicating malt liquor or <br />wine. <br />B. Minimum Penalty: The purpose of this section is to establish a standard by which the City <br />Council determines the civil fine, the length of license suspensions and the propriety of <br />revocations, and shall apply to all premises licensed under this chapter. These penalties are <br />presumed to be appropriate for every case; however, the council may deviate in an <br />individual case where the council finds that there exist certain extenuating or aggravating <br />circumstances, making it more appropriate to deviate, such as, but not limited to, a <br />licensee's efforts in combination with the state or city to prevent the sale of alcohol to <br />minors or, in the converse, when a licensee has a history of repeated violations of state or <br />local liquor laws. When deviating from these standards, the council will provide written <br />findings that support the penalty selected. When a violation occurs, the staff shall provide <br />information to the City Council to either assess the presumptive penalty or depart upward <br />or downward based on extenuating or aggravating circumstances.
